Design & Performance
This snapback is constructed from a medium-weight fabric blend of 98% cotton and 2% elastane. The high cotton content ensures that the cap remains breathable during physical activity, while the integrated elastane provides a subtle stretch that accommodates the natural movement of the head. The structured panels are designed to sit firmly, providing a stable platform for customisation and ensuring the cap does not lose its profile over time. Practical Advice
This cap is a one-size-fits-most design, specifically tailored to fit a 58cm head circumference with the snapback closure allowing for further adjustment. When selecting your customisation, consider that the MultiCam pattern is visually detailed; choosing contrasting thread colours for embroidery will ensure your company logo remains clear and legible against the camouflage background.
Caring for your product
To maintain the performance and professional appearance of this cap, it is essential to follow the care guidelines strictly. Maintaining the structural integrity of the crown and the vibrancy of the licensed MultiCam pattern requires that you do not wash this garment. Standard machine washing can damage the internal stiffening of the cap, causing it to lose its shape and professional profile.
Bleaching and dry cleaning must be avoided as these processes use harsh chemicals that can degrade the cotton fibres and cause the specialised camouflage pattern to fade or bleed. Similarly, do not tumble dry or iron the cap, as excessive heat can damage the elastane fibres and warp the brim. To keep your cap looking its best, we recommend a gentle spot clean with a damp cloth for any surface marks.
